What Is Sleep Apnea?

Sleep apnea is a common and serious sleep disorder where breathing repeatedly starts and stops during sleep. Affecting an estimated 1 billion adults globally, including 22 million Americans, it's particularly prevalent among those aged 30 to 70 and increases in risk with age.

Recognizing sleep apnea can be crucial. Common signs include loud snoring accompanied by gasping or choking sounds, prolonged pauses in breathing during sleep, excessive daytime sleepiness, frequent awakenings at night, morning headaches, dry mouth, and frequent nighttime urination. If you or your partner observe these symptoms, it's essential to seek a diagnosis. Sleep studies, conducted either at home or in a sleep clinic, can accurately determine the presence of sleep apnea.

What Are the Risk Factors for Sleep Apnea?

Several factors can increase your risk of developing sleep apnea. These include advancing age, particularly after 60, with men being more susceptible than women. Excess weight, especially with a high BMI or a large neck circumference, significantly raises the risk. Lifestyle choices like smoking and alcohol consumption, especially before bed, can worsen sleep apnea. Certain health conditions, such as high blood pressure, diabetes, and chronic nasal congestion, can also increase susceptibility. In women, menopause can elevate the risk. If you or someone you know exhibits any of these risk factors, it's advisable to consider a sleep study to determine if sleep apnea is present.


The Link Between Sleep Apnea and Erectile Dysfunction

A significant number of men with sleep apnea also struggle with erectile dysfunction. In fact, a staggering 92% of men with severe sleep apnea experience ED. Even in milder cases, the prevalence of ED among individuals with sleep apnea is substantially higher than in the general population, ranging from 40% to 80%. This strong link highlights a crucial connection between sleep quality and sexual health. Poor sleep, particularly when disrupted by sleep apnea, can significantly impact hormone levels, blood flow, and nerve function, all of which are essential for healthy sexual function.

How Sleep Apnea Leads to Erectile Dysfunction

  • Lower Testosterone Levels
    Sleep apnea disrupts REM sleep, which is crucial for producing testosterone—the key hormone responsible for sexual function. Low testosterone levels can make it difficult to achieve and maintain an erection.
  • Inflammation and Reduced Blood Flow
    Sleep apnea leads to blood vessel inflammation, reducing nitric oxide production, which is essential for healthy erections. When blood vessels are constricted and inflamed, blood flow to the penis is restricted.
  • Nerve Damage and Sleep Disruptions
    Sleep apnea affects the nervous system, making it harder for the brain to send the right signals to trigger an erection. Interrupted sleep cycles also contribute to mood disorders, stress, and anxiety, which further impact sexual performance.

If you suffer from ED, you should consider getting tested for sleep apnea. Addressing your sleep issues may significantly improve your sexual health.


Treating Sleep Apnea Can Improve Erectile Dysfunction

The good news is that sleep apnea is a treatable condition. By effectively managing it, you can experience a range of benefits, including increased testosterone levels, improved blood flow, and enhanced sexual performance. Continuous Positive Airway Pressure (CPAP) therapy is considered the gold standard treatment for sleep apnea. This therapy involves using a CPAP machine, which gently delivers a steady stream of air to keep your airway open throughout the night. This ensures proper oxygen flow and significantly improves the quality of your sleep.

In addition to CPAP therapy, incorporating lifestyle changes can further reduce sleep apnea symptoms and improve your overall sexual health. Regular exercise, especially if it leads to weight loss, can significantly alleviate sleep apnea symptoms. Quitting smoking is crucial, as it not only worsens sleep apnea but also damages blood vessels. Limiting alcohol intake, particularly before bedtime, is essential as alcohol can disrupt sleep patterns and worsen apnea symptoms.

Finally, practicing good sleep hygiene, such as maintaining a consistent sleep schedule and avoiding screens before bed, can greatly enhance your sleep quality.
